Observation¶
openQA test in scenario sle-15-Installer-DVD-x86_64-gnome_smb@64bit
bootloader
does not show that it would switch the install source which it should.
Acceptance criteria¶
- AC1: Installation is conducted over SMB as install source
Tasks¶
- check if it works when just setting parameter "NETBOOT=1" -> follow https://openqa.suse.de/tests/1405854
- crosscheck openSUSE

https://openqa.suse.de/tests/1405880#step/bootloader/15 shows it working now. So the problem was the missing NETBOOT=1
variable which I added now in the test suite as well as the samba server being gone (see related ticket). https://openqa.suse.de/tests/1405854#step/welcome/4 is a failure that shows that actually the SMB server is probed.
openSUSE does not have SMB, see #15136
